Technical Specifications

  • Brand: Utopia
  • SKU: DY319
  • Dimensions: 260(Ø)mm | 10¼"
  • Box Quantity: 6
  • Weight (per box): 5.18kg
  • Material: Super Vitrified Porcelain
  • Colour: White
  • Standard: Conforms to BS4034 British Hotelware Standard
  • Features: Microwave Safe, Dishwasher Safe, Resists Metal Marking

Buying Guide: Choosing the Right Restaurant Crockery

Not sure which plates are the perfect match for your venue? Here are a few key pointers to help you decide.

Material is Key

Porcelain, like these Utopia Titan plates, offers a fantastic blend of elegance and  strength. For a more rustic feel, consider stoneware, but be aware it may be less durable in a commercial setting.

The Right Size for the Job

A 260mm (10.25") plate is the industry standard for a main course. Ensure you have a range of matching smaller plates (8-9") for starters and  side dishes to maintain a cohesive look.

Rim Style Matters

The narrow rim plate style is a chef's favourite as it maximises the plating area. A wide rim, by contrast, creates a frame for the food, which can look very dramatic and  upmarket.

Look for the Standard

Always check for the BS4034 Hotelware Standard. It's an independent certification that the product is tough enough for the hospitality industry, guaranteeing chip resistance and  durability.

Feel the Weight

A good quality plate should have a reassuring heft without being cumbersome for waiting staff to carry. This weight signifies a dense, vitrified body that resists breakage.

Q: What does 'resists metal marking' mean in practice?

A: It means the hard glaze is specially formulated to prevent the greyish lines that can be left behind by stainless steel cutlery, keeping the plates looking clean.

Q: Is the base of the plate glazed or unglazed?

A: The foot of the plate is typically unglazed and  polished to prevent it from scratching other plates when stacked.

What Does 'Super Vitrified Body' Mean For Your Kitchen?

You'll often see the term 'vitrified' when looking at professional crockery, but what does it actually mean? In simple terms, vitrification is a process where the porcelain is fired at an extremely high temperature. This fuses the clay particles together, turning the plate into a single, glass-like (vitreous), non-porous body.

Think of it like the difference between a sponge and  a block of glass. A standard plate is slightly porous like a sponge, absorbing tiny amounts of water, oil, and  bacteria over time. This leads to weakness, staining, and  cracking when temperatures change. A vitrified plate is like the block of glass – nothing gets in. This makes it significantly stronger, more hygienic, completely dishwasher and  microwave safe, and  far more resistant to the chipping and  breakage that costs your business money.
